Title:
METHOD FOR PRODUCING A METAL BODY MADE OF AT LEAST TWO VISUALLY DIFFERENT METALS

Abstract:
The invention relates to the production of a metal body, which is made of at least two different metals, in particular for producing jewelry pieces and watch pieces. According to the invention, at least a partial area of the metal body is produced by pouring a noble metal slip into a mold. The noble metal slip is molded into a solid green body by drying the noble metal slip. The material of the green body can be brought in contact with a second metal before or after the drying. The product produced in such a way is then sintered to form a solid metal body. The second metal can be present as a slip or in metal form. The method enables a large number of design possibilities in a simple manner. For example, grained or marbled metal bodies can be produced. Furthermore, the metal body, from which the jewelry pieces or watch pieces are produced, can be provided with surfaces patterned as desired. For example, a grain (2) of yellow gold can be added to a body (1) made of white gold.
